Transaction 39ed70be35bf4191b40f301619cb5ca20af9fe9d16a9bca94f8657f86a2e6ea6
1 Input
2 Outputs
- 39ed70be35bf4191b40f301619cb5ca20af9fe9d16a9bca94f8657f86a2e6ea6:0
- 39ed70be35bf4191b40f301619cb5ca20af9fe9d16a9bca94f8657f86a2e6ea6:1
value 100000000
address 17XXoHpTG7R332bKp7azmoEKeC9wHkdgqh
value 4768543031
address 1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x